Wed, February 26, 2014 - Kansas City's River Market area was known in the 1970s as River Quay, a redeveloped home to restaurants and bohemian shopsand site of a violent Mafia turf war. In 1954, Leonardo and Josephine Mirabile and their son, Jasper and his wife, Josephine, opened Roses Bar, a neighborhood Italian restaurant and bar at 75th Street and Wornall Road. A favorite of President Harry S. Truman, Dixons chili comes in three styles (juicy, soupy with bean broth, or dry), a variety of fixins including onion, grated cheese, jalapeno relish and sour cream, and a choice of plates such as a tamale covered with chili beans and meat; beans covered with meat; and spaghetti with chili meat and beans. Located in the Westin Crown Center for decades, the Polynesian-themed restaurant featured a Tiki Bar atmosphere with Asian/Oceania food and Kansas City classics. Annies Santa Fe was a popular Mexican restaurant during the 1980s and 1990s which had locations at several local malls, including Oak Park Mall and Bannister Mall.
